 Re: Best CFM trade targets
 
 Here's a few Offensive Players that you probably wouldn't have to fleece the trade system for and could acquire fairly while still getting that good ol' Madden fantasy trade vibe.
 
 Jacoby Brissett, QB Colts
 CJ Beathard, QB 49ers
 Davis Webb, QB Giants
 Corey Clement, RB Eagles
 Tarik Cohen, RB Bears
 Spence Ware, RB Chiefs
 Dede Westbrook, WR Jaguars
 Carlos Henderson, WR Broncos
 Curtis Samuel, WR Panthers
 Gerald Everett, TE Rams
 Ricky Seals-Jones, TE Cardinals
 Maxx Williams, TE Ravens
